Leadership Seneca County was hosted by the Seneca Soil and Water Conservation District on April 12th. Participants had the opportunity to learn about the importance of Seneca County agriculture in our everyday life through a farm to fork activity. Participants also toured Proving Ground Farm and the Eric Eberhard farm to learn about the latest advancements in farming techniques. The day ended with a presentation by ST Genetics.

Rocking ER Farm Store Celebrates New Location in Attica

Congratulations to Elizabeth and Riley McCullough on the opening of Rocking ER Farm Store's new location at 8 South Main Street in Attica!


Rocking ER Farm Store was established in 2020. Elizabeth and Robby's son, Riley, rodeoed and he wanted to help pay some of his entry fees and started to sell produce in 2017. Each year they continued to grow and finally outgrew their pop-up tent. The ideas began to roll in and Rocking ER Farm Store was created that would offer a wide variety of products all-year round.


Rocking ER Farm Store is a country store with a variety of items; from home décor, candy, pet supplies, unique gifts, clothing, and more! They also have locally-made products including health and beauty products, candles and wax melts, hides, signs, tables, benches, flags, jewelry, and more. Tiffin Pool Center Celebrates 50th Anniversary

Congratulations to Summer and Sloan Rhoad and the entire Tiffin Pool Center team on their 50th anniversary!


Tiffin Pool Center, located at 730 Miami Street in Tiffin, was established in 1973 and it has remained in their family ever since. They are owner-operators that only handle quality pool products and they pride themselves on having professional and courteous service. They offer BioGuard® chemicals, Hayward® filters and pumps, GLI Vinyl® liners, Meyco® mesh covers and a variety of above-ground pools along with many accessories.


They have added computerized water analysis to help their customers have the sparkling water they desire. They have a service department that does everything from installing pools to replacing liners, heaters, filters and pumps. They also have a retail store with lots of parts, toys, goggles, chemicals, and more. Over the years, they have prided themselves on being able to give their customers the enviable backyard they want and deserve so that they can enjoy for years and years to come.
